Travelling from Sir Seewoosagur Ramgoolam International Airport (MRU) to London Gatwick Airport (LGW): what you need to know

  • Around 12 hours 35 minutes is how long you can expect to be in the air on a direct flight from Sir Seewoosagur Ramgoolam International Airport to London Gatwick Airport.

  • London's timezone is UTC+0, making London four hours behind Port Louis.

  • Every week, there are 13 Sir Seewoosagur Ramgoolam International Airport to London Gatwick Airport flights. If you want to be on board as soon as possible, go for the 20:40 British Airways flight. If you'd rather make the most of your day before you fly, the last departure is at 22:25 with Air Mauritius.

  • Leave plenty of time to make your MRU to LGW flight. As a general rule, arrive at least two hours before international departures and an hour ahead for domestic flights.

  • During popular months such as July, you'll want to get to the airport earlier. Plan to arrive two hours before a domestic departure and four hours ahead of an international flight when you fly during a high season in general.

  • British Airways is your gateway to exploring London (and perhaps some other exciting corners of United Kingdom!). Browse the direct flights from Sir Seewoosagur Ramgoolam International Airport to London Gatwick Airport offered by this carrier.

  • British Airways is the top choice for travellers on this route.

  • British Airways is a leader in on-time performance for MRU to LGW flights, with 92.31% of its services reaching their destination on schedule.

Getting from London Gatwick Airport (LGW) to central London

  • London Gatwick Airport is roughly 80 kilometres from central London. The drive time takes around 1 hour 20 minutes.

  • It takes roughly 1 hour 25 minutes if you're travelling by public transport.

When to fly to London Gatwick Airport (LGW)

  • It's time to pick your travel dates for your flight from Sir Seewoosagur Ramgoolam International Airport to London Gatwick Airport. August is the busiest month to visit London. If you prefer a more laid-back vibe, go in January.

  • When reserving your flight from Sir Seewoosagur Ramgoolam International Airport to London Gatwick Airport, think about the type of weather you enjoy. July is the warmest month in London, with the temperature ranging from 11ºC (52ºF) to 26ºC (79ºF).

  • If you like cooler conditions, search for a cheap ticket from MRU to LGW in January. Temperatures average between 0ºC (32ºF) and 9ºC (48ºF) then.
